Guiding questions for the creation of such a data policy in the context of the Smart City Bamberg are discussed. Furthermore, the report shows how the smart cities of Barcelona, Hamburg, Helsinki, Stuttgart, Vienna and Zurich proceed. The presented analysis is based on public documents and interviews.engSmart CityData Policy004Data policy models in European smart cities : Experiences, opportunities and challenges in data policies in Europeworkingpaper
